Course Details
• Ecological Principles in Garden Ecosystems: Understanding the fundamental ecological concepts and processes that govern sustainable garden ecosystems.
• Soil Management and Conservation: Practices to enhance soil health, fertility, and structure for sustainable gardening.
• Plant Selection and Biodiversity: Choosing climate-appropriate, diverse plant species to create resilient and balanced garden ecosystems.
• Integrated Pest Management: Strategies for managing pests and diseases using ecological methods and reducing the use of chemical controls.
• Water Management and Conservation: Techniques for efficient water use, rainwater harvesting, and managing water resources in garden ecosystems.
• Wildlife Habitat Creation: Designing and maintaining garden ecosystems that support local wildlife, pollinators, and biodiversity.
• Climate Change Adaptation: Understanding the impacts of climate change on garden ecosystems and implementing adaptive strategies.
• Sustainable Landscape Design: Designing gardens that are functional, aesthetically pleasing, and environmentally responsible.
• Community Engagement and Education: Engaging with local communities to promote sustainable gardening practices and build capacity.
